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
78569 7586 91 390
0487 65295743175
0487 65295743175
0067838 227013 14105 6594552802 837047291
All about undefined
Interested in learning more?
0487 65295743175
0067838 227013 14105 6594552802 837047291
See more
093 7212631 26851
21148 64 503
See more
297523 425 915709091
22874 410669332 453 812562889
See more